Practice deep breathing to help you through your speech. Taking deep breaths and then exhaling all the way before giving a speech can reduce nerves.Breathe in for four seconds and exhale slowly.Do this about 6 times to feel a positive difference in how calm you feel.

Have some water with you can refresh yourself if necessary. Don’t drink dairy drinks or soda immediately prior to your speech. These fluids can produce mucous or thicken your saliva. A nice cup of hot tea before a speech can help relax tense vocal chords.

Visual Aids

Make sure your visual aids you use are not so dazzling as to be distracting. You only want them to underscore your speech. You do not want them to overwhelm the message. Use visual aids to make a point. They need to be attractive and colorful without distracting from your presentation.

If you inadvertently skipped a sentence, keep going. You will ruin your momentum if you try and backtrack to include the missing information. Additionally, backing up will just make it abundantly clear to your audience that you messed up.
